What point-and-capture measurement captures
From one calibrated image, the system extracts:
- Length, width, and surface area — computed from the wound boundary, not estimated from a ruler laid alongside it.
- Depth — inferred from structured light or reference markers, replacing the swab-and-guess method.
- Tissue composition — percentages of granulation, slough, eschar, and epithelial tissue, segmented from the image.
- Periwound assessment — condition of surrounding skin, captured in the same frame.
- Undermining and tunneling markers — logged as structured data tied to clock positions.
Every value lands in the chart as structured data, not free text. That matters for trending, for audits, and for handoffs between clinicians.
Why objective measurement changes the audit conversation
Ruler measurements vary by clinician, by lighting, by how the wound is oriented. Two nurses measuring the same wound routinely disagree by 20% or more. When an auditor reviews a chart looking for healing progress or medical necessity for continued debridement, that variability is a problem. An image tied to a timestamp, with reproducible measurements pulled from the same pixels every time, is not.

Where the measurements go next
Structured measurement data feeds the healing analytics dashboard, where trajectory becomes visible across visits. A wound that isn't closing shows up as a flattening curve, not as a hunch three visits later. That's the difference between reactive and proactive wound care — and it's only possible when the underlying measurement is consistent.
